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3742752308 10721094 83646850
65 75245540
65 75245540
61 33865032045 30809 40 7950387863
All about undefined
Interested in learning more?
65 75245540
61 33865032045 30809 40 7950387863
See more
31601459 30 2228
75279012 919 83 898876332
See more
429 90338571729 854786
2143129052 080693 761
See more